What Are Free Radicals and Environmental Stressors?
Free radicals are unstable molecules generated by sunlight, pollution, and everyday stress. They react with healthy skin cells, leading to:
- Oxidative stress that damages collagen and elastin
- Premature ageing, fine lines, and wrinkles
- Loss of hydration and a compromised skin barrier
- Dull, uneven skin tone
Antioxidants help neutralise free radicals before they cause visible damage, maintaining your skin’s health and natural glow.

Vitamin C: A Key Antioxidant
Vitamin C is a powerful antioxidant with multiple skin benefits:
- Protects against UV and pollution-related free radicals
- Reduces hyperpigmentation and dark spots
- Supports collagen production to maintain firmness
- Enhances skin brightness and radiance

Other Important Antioxidants in Skincare
Vitamin C works best alongside other antioxidants, which can complement and enhance its effects:
- Vitamin E: Protects cell membranes from oxidative stress and stabilises vitamin C for longer-lasting benefits. - Ferulic Acid: Enhances antioxidant power and reduces damage caused by environmental stressors.

- Resveratrol and Coenzyme Q10: Neutralise free radicals and help maintain skin elasticity.
